Chuyển màu công thức Mathtype hàng loạt trong Word

Thứ hai - 01/04/2019 17:02
Trong quá trình sử dụng Microsoft Office, quý thầy cô cần thay đổi màu của công thức Mathtype có thể xem các cách làm được hướng dẫn trong bài viết sau đây
Chuyển màu công thức Mathtype hàng loạt trong Word
1. Đổi màu công thức Mathtype bằng chức năng Toogle Tex.
Để thực hiện theo cách này, quý thầy cô làm theo các bước sau
B1. Đồng bộ hóa công thức Mathtype
B2. CTRL + A và chọn Toggle Tex (Nếu công thức có \[ và \] thì tiếp B3 và B4)
B3. CTRL + H thay thế toàn bộ \[ bởi $.
B4. CTRL + H thay thế toàn bộ \] bởi $.
B5. CTRL + H thay thế toàn bộ $ bởi $\color{màu} màu = blue, red, white, green, ...
B6. CTRL + A và chọn Toggle Tex B7. CTRL + H thay thế toàn bộ \color{màu} bởi không gì cả . Vậy là xong.
Video hướng dẫn chi tiết

 
2. Sử dụng Code VBA.
Sub ChangeColorMT()
mau = "$\color{blue}"
Application.ScreenUpdating = False
Selection.WholeStory
Application.Run MacroName:="MTCommand_TeXToggle"

 With Selection.Find
        .ClearFormatting
        .text = "($)(*$)"
        .Replacement.text = "#$" & "\2"
        .Replacement.ClearFormatting
        .Wrap = wdFindContinue
        .MatchCase = True
        .MatchWildcards = True
        .Execute Replace:=wdReplaceAll, Forward:=True
    End With
 With Selection.Find
        .ClearFormatting
        .text = "#$"
        .Replacement.text = mau
        .Replacement.ClearFormatting
        .Wrap = wdFindContinue
        .MatchCase = True
        .MatchWildcards = False
        .Execute Replace:=wdReplaceAll, Forward:=True
    End With

 With Selection.Find
        .ClearFormatting
        .text = "\["
        .Replacement.text = mau
        .Replacement.ClearFormatting
        .Wrap = wdFindContinue
        .MatchCase = True
        .MatchWildcards = False
        .Execute Replace:=wdReplaceAll, Forward:=True
    End With
 With Selection.Find
        .ClearFormatting
        .text = "\]"
        .Replacement.text = "$"
        .Replacement.ClearFormatting
        .Wrap = wdFindContinue
        .MatchCase = True
        .MatchWildcards = False
        .Execute Replace:=wdReplaceAll, Forward:=True
    End With
Selection.WholeStory
Application.Run MacroName:="MTCommand_TeXToggle"
Selection.HomeKey Unit:=wdStory
Application.ScreenUpdating = True
End Sub
Video hướng dẫn 
 

Tác giả bài viết: Nguyễn Duy Chiến

Tổng số điểm của bài viết là: 0 trong 0 đánh giá

Click để đánh giá bài viết

  Ý kiến bạn đọc

Những tin mới hơn

Những tin cũ hơn

Thăm dò ý kiến

Làm sao bạn biết page Toán học Bắc Trung Nam?

Bạn đã không sử dụng Site, Bấm vào đây để duy trì trạng thái đăng nhập. Thời gian chờ: 60 giây